James H. Lockard was the son of James T. and Jane Lockart. He was the husband of Mary (Schrauger) Lockart. Mary died September 17, 1879. James was a contractor on public works. He and his brother David built the French Creek feeder or Canal from Meadville to Conneaut Lake, to provide a feeder for the Erie and Pittsburg Canal. James also helped build a section of the Erie Railroad in the vicinity of Elmira, New York in 1849 and 1850.

Commemorative biographical record of Central Pennsylvania: including counties of Centre, Clearfield, Jefferson and Clarion, Pgs. 1487-1488
